M. G. M. van Roosmalen is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and Paleontology. According to data from OpenAlex, M. G. M. van Roosmalen has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 690 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Social Psychology, 7 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and 5 papers in Paleontology. Recurrent topics in M. G. M. van Roosmalen’s work include Primate Behavior and Ecology (10 papers), Evolution and Paleontology Studies (5 papers) and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(4 papers). M. G. M. van Roosmalen is often cited by papers focused on Primate Behavior and Ecology (10 papers), Evolution and Paleontology Studies (5 papers) and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(4 papers). M. G. M. van Roosmalen collaborates with scholars based in Brazil, United States and Colombia. M. G. M. van Roosmalen's co-authors include Russell A. Mittermeier, Howard S. Ginsberg, William R. Konstant, Carlos A. Peres and John G. Fleagle and has published in prestigious journals such as Oikos, American Journal of Primatology and Primates.
